๐ถ Sylvia warblers are small birds known for their beautiful songs that they use to communicate.
๐ณ These birds mostly live in Europe, Africa, and Asia, and enjoy wooded areas.
๐ฆ Typical warblers measure around 10 to 18 centimeters long and have slender bodies.
๐ฆ The genus Sylvia includes about 16 different species, like the Common Whitethroat and Garden Warbler.
๐ฅณ During the breeding season, male warblers sing to attract female partners.
๐ Sylvia warblers migrate to warmer regions during the winter and return in the spring.
๐ Their diet mainly consists of insects, but they also love berries and seeds.
๐ก Female Sylvia warblers build nests hidden in bushes or tall grass.
๐ Some species of Sylvia warblers face threats due to habitat loss and climate change.
๐ผ Each species of Sylvia has its own unique song, making them fascinating to birdwatchers!
